  • Dan and Nick break down the draft profile of Marvin Harrison Jr. the wide receiver out of Ohio State and as you can tell from the title of this show -- he's one of their favorite prospects they've had the opportunity to evaluate not just in this draft class but any. The clear-cut WR1 for both Dan and Nick and they break down exactly why referencing the tape first and foremost, advanced stats, raw stats, the variations in his route running and how he translates to the NFL speed and rules. Finally, they discuss the big picture and whether or not he's a player the Giants should trade up for, target at 6 and which QBs they would draft Harrison over.
